§ 71-245 — Reciprocal license; provisions applicable

Nebraska·Ch. 71 Public Health and Welfare
The provisions of the Barber Act, relating to applications, transmittal of the names of eligible candidates, certification of successful applicants, and issuance of licenses thereto, in the case of regular examinations, apply as far as applicable to applicants for a reciprocal license or for a license issued without examination pursuant to section 71-239.01 .

Legislative History

Source: Laws 1983, LB 87, § 8; Laws 1997, LB 622, § 99; Laws 2009, LB195, § 66.
